Output 51488559002b723958b1287b3a5d87d88b1fb0cf98a62fcb8fe661478cdd5a00:1

value
21520356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 883e5c6b4c18070dd9a58ab246392e776f10580e OP_EQUALVERIFY OP_CHECKSIG
address
1DRPc1U1JVuYSLXqHgbUHbAvTVj4XAVc7w
transaction
51488559002b723958b1287b3a5d87d88b1fb0cf98a62fcb8fe661478cdd5a00
spent
true